Identifying Tick Habitats
Ticks are often found in environments that offer shelter and moisture. Here are common locations where ticks can thrive:
- Wooded areas
- Tall grasses
- Leaf litter
- Near water sources

Preventative Measures
To minimize tick exposure, implement the following strategies:
- Mow your lawn regularly.
- Clear away tall grass and brush.
- Use barriers like wood chips to separate your yard from wooded areas.
